Extra-time agony as brave Lions crash out

-

ENGLAND’S glorious World Cup run came to an agonising end last night.

Gareth Southgate’s braves fell to a painful extra-time defeat in the Luzhniki Stadium.

They held the lead for more than an hour after scoring in the fifth minute, thanks to Kieran Trippier’s superb free-kick – but finally ran out of steam.

Ivan Perisic equalised midway from JEREMY CROSS in Moscow

through the second half when he got to a cross ahead of Kyle Walker.

And Mario Mandzukic reacted quickest to grab the winner in the 109th minute.

It brought to an end a memorable campaign that restored the country’s faith in the Three Lions.

And it surely heralds the beginning of a bright future under an outstandin­g coach.
